Erie County, PA vs Maricopa County, AZ
Property Tax Rate Comparison 2025
Quick Answer
Erie County, PA: 1.93% effective rate · $3,584/yr median tax · median home $185,714
Maricopa County, AZ: 0.52% effective rate · $1,776/yr median tax · median home $341,666
Side-by-Side Comparison
| Metric | Erie County, PA | Maricopa County, AZ | National Avg |
|---|---|---|---|
| Effective Tax Rate | 1.93% | 0.52% | 1.06% |
| Median Annual Tax | $3,584 | $1,776 | $2,778 |
| Median Home Value | $185,714 | $341,666 | $268,728 |
| Population | 269,728 | 4,485,414 | — |

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the property tax difference between Erie County and Maricopa County?
Erie County, PA has an effective property tax rate of 1.93% with a median annual tax of $3,584. Maricopa County, AZ has a rate of 0.52% with a median annual tax of $1,776. The difference is 1.41 percentage points.
Which county has higher property taxes, Erie County or Maricopa County?
Erie County, PA has the higher effective property tax rate at 1.93% compared to 0.52%.
How do Erie County and Maricopa County compare to the national average?
The national average effective property tax rate is 1.06%. Erie County is above average at 1.93%, and Maricopa County is below average at 0.52%.
